Ok, do you need sources or binaries?
Create the virtual machine to esxi and add hardware:
- IDE controller with single harddisk (vmdk file in archive). Boot from this.
- PVSCSI controller and raw harddisks or vmdk files for data. I've tested with 3 disks so far.
- VMXNET3 network. Only single interface in bridged mode is tested so far. MAC address can be anything.
